Job Description:

If you’re a talented, passionate and dedicated childcare professional looking for your next step, our welcoming and warm nursery at RAFAKidz Worthy Down is the place for you! With our friendly team and small room sizes we can offer exciting experiences every day. Located in a beautiful setting close to Winchester and Andover, our little RAFAKidz family are always busy with trips out, picnics, parties and outdoor learning. For every child that comes through the doors of RAFAKidz, no matter their ability, background or circumstances, we provide experiences that will help them be confident and reach their full potential.

Requirements:

  • To manage the day-to-day activities to ensure the smooth running of your room
  • Support the development of good practice with regards to special needs and inclusion
  • Implement and support others in delivering, the EYFS in line with current practice and guidelines
  • To ensure effective staff deployment in your designated room to support staff deployment across the nursery
  • In conjunction with the senior management team identify and address individual training needs of playroom staff
  • Provide leadership and support to room staff to enable them to establish and maintain positive working relationships
  • Ensure the effective implementation of the Key Worker procedures and allocate children to key workers appropriately
What we offer:
  • Subsidised childcare to all permanent staff
  • Refer a Friend Bonus
  • Access to internal promotions
  • Cycle to Work Scheme
